What is the graph of XY constant?

What is the graph of XY constant?

The graph of the equation xy = k,where k is a positive constant, is given here for k = 1. This figure is known as a rectangular hyperbola.

What is the equation of rectangular hyperbola?

The rectangular hyperbola then has equation of the form xy=c 2. For example, y=1/x is a rectangular hyperbola. For xy=c 2, it is customary to take c>0 and to use, as parametric equations, x=ct, y=c/t (t ≠ 0).

What is a rectangular hyperbola?

A hyperbola for which the asymptotes are perpendicular, also called an equilateral hyperbola or right hyperbola. This occurs when the semimajor and semiminor axes are equal.

How do you graph a hyperbola?

Graphing Hyperbolas

  1. Determine if it is horizontal or vertical. Find the center point, a, and b.
  2. Graph the center point.
  3. Use the a value to find the two vertices.
  4. Use the b value to draw the guiding box and asymptotes.
  5. Draw the hyperbola.
